marcelboot Geplaatst: 27 december 2007 Geplaatst: 27 december 2007 Ik heb een loop in een script dat moet stoppen als een bepaald jaar is aangekomen in een datumveld. Dit laat ik in de definitie vastleggen door de Year(datum) te laten vergelijken met de harde datum in het gemaakte veld/record. Dit werkt dus niet. Wat doe ik verkeerd of waar is mijn logica te blond voor woorden??? Quote
0 hbrendel Geplaatst: 27 december 2007 Geplaatst: 27 december 2007 Het lijkt me dat je een jaar niet met een datum moet vergelijken. Wanneer het onzin is wat ik zeg, post dan je script, dan kunnen we het zelf zien. Quote
0 marcelboot Geplaatst: 27 december 2007 Auteur Geplaatst: 27 december 2007 Dit is de scriptregel waar het om gaat: Exit Loop if (Year ( Appointments::ApptDate ) = Appointments::Eindjaar) Snappen we elkaar? marcel Quote
0 Peter-Paul Geplaatst: 27 december 2007 Geplaatst: 27 december 2007 Wat voor veld is Appointments::Eindjaar? Quote
0 marcelboot Geplaatst: 27 december 2007 Auteur Geplaatst: 27 december 2007 Het zijn beide datumvelden. De laatste is een global. Quote
0 Peter-Paul Geplaatst: 27 december 2007 Geplaatst: 27 december 2007 Dan moet je van de laatste global ook het jaar nemen, dus Exit Loop if (Year ( Appointments::ApptDate ) = Year(Appointments::Eindjaar) ) Quote
0 marcelboot Geplaatst: 27 december 2007 Auteur Geplaatst: 27 december 2007 Inmiddels heb ik er een datum van gemaakt en dan loopt het wel tot de juiste dag door. Dank voor het meedenken. Quote
0 Peter-Paul Geplaatst: 27 december 2007 Geplaatst: 27 december 2007 Het zijn beide datumvelden. De laatste is een global. Inmiddels heb ik er een datum van gemaakt en dan loopt het wel tot de juiste dag door. Dank voor het meedenken.. Dit snap ik niet helemaal? Quote
0 marcelboot Geplaatst: 27 december 2007 Auteur Geplaatst: 27 december 2007 Eerst had ik het jaartal, bijvoorbeeld 2009 en u heb ik gewoon een bepaalde dag genomen en op die dag stopt de loop. Simpel eigenlijk, he? Quote
Vraag
marcelboot
Ik heb een loop in een script dat moet stoppen als een bepaald jaar is aangekomen in een datumveld.
Dit laat ik in de definitie vastleggen door de Year(datum) te laten vergelijken met de harde datum in het gemaakte veld/record.
Dit werkt dus niet.
Wat doe ik verkeerd of waar is mijn logica te blond voor woorden???
8 antwoorden op deze vraag
Aanbevolen berichten
Doe mee aan dit gesprek
Je kunt dit nu plaatsen en later registreren. Indien je reeds een account hebt, log dan nu in om het bericht te plaatsen met je account.